Understanding Japan’s Electrical System
As I prepared for my trip to Japan, I quickly learned that the country operates on a unique electrical system. Japan uses a voltage of 100V and a frequency of either 50Hz or 60Hz, depending on the region. This was crucial for me to understand, as my devices from home were designed for a different voltage and frequency.
Types of Plug Converters
When looking for a plug converter, I discovered that there are different types available. The most common plug types in Japan are Type A and Type B. Type A has two flat parallel pins, while Type B includes an additional round pin for grounding. I found it important to choose a converter that matches the plug type of my devices to avoid any compatibility issues.
Voltage Compatibility
One of the key aspects I had to consider was voltage compatibility. Many devices, such as chargers and laptops, can handle a range of voltages, but others cannot. I made sure to check the labels on my devices to see if they were dual voltage (100V-240V). If they weren’t, I knew I would need a voltage converter in addition to a plug converter.
